Wheat and Oats Varietal Responses to Applications of Alkanolamine Salt of 2,4‐D1

Clive Price, Glenn C. Klingman

Open publisher page 2 citations

Abstract

Synopsis Treatment of 27 winter wheat varieties resulted in decreased yields in 2 varieties when treated March 1 with ½ pound per acre of 2,4‐D; in 24 when treated November 26 with ½ pound per acre; in 17 when treated March 1 with 2.0 pounds per acre; and in 26 when treated November 26 with 2.0 pounds per acre. Treatment of 29 winter oat varieties resulted in decreased yields in 3 varieties when treated March 1 with ½ pound per acre; in 26 when treated November 26 with ½ pound per acre; in 26 when treated March 1 with 2.0 pounds per acre; and in 29 when treated November 26 with 2.0 pounds per acre.
